    I have the serial that came with my machine - but there is a weird "rule" (MS/HP screwing the end user) that doesn't let you do a fresh install using the OEM serial number.

    That's why I'll have to install using a "MS Generic" serial number (MS actually provides a list of these....), and after installing using that S/N, change the serial to the OEM one that is stored in the BIOS.

    I've done a little research, and it seems this is the best way to get a fresh install on a machine that came with a pre-loaded OS and no recovery media.
